STEP 1/8
I looked for something in the refrigerator.
Tofu, dallae, radish, pepper, mushrooms, onions
I prepared little by little.
(Prepare minced garlic and green onions)
STEP 2/8
If there's no earthen pot, put it in the pot
You can make broth separately,
I'm just going to put anchovies and kelp in the soybean paste stew and boil it.
STEP 3/8
The broth is getting ready...
The vegetables are cut and trimmed.
STEP 4/8
When it's broth... Put in the radish first
STEP 5/8
If you see the radishes cooked...
Mix the soybean paste..
(Please refer to the supermarket soybean paste because it doesn't taste good.)
STEP 6/8
After radish, add tofu and onions
STEP 7/8
I put garlic, green onions, and it was boiling
Lastly, I'll put in the dallae and mushrooms
One more time. Boiling
STEP 8/8
I think the doenjang jjigae is delicious when it's boiled lightly boiled.
Dallae, add the mushrooms at the end,
